ClearQAM/ATSC dual tuner with hardware encoder, quick channel altering, even with HD channels, additional inputs for fairly a lot whatever. I didn't try to watch any of my old VHS so not confident if they pass Macrovision or not. No CableCard assistance?The IR receiver wasn't lengthy enough for my wants so I had to extend it working with some USB cable and soldering capabilities. Nonetheless, my Computer is on the other side of a wall from my Television that I am using. About a month soon after I purchased this card my cable provider stopped sending ClearQAM, so now if I only get a couple of channels alternatively of my full line up. So if you strategy to get this for ClearQAM help on best of your current cable subscription you need to almost certainly ask your cable provider if they plan to continue ClearQAM or program to encrypt all of it and require a CableCard setup (popular brand of DVR product comes to thoughts).

Simple to set up this card and get running for HDTV over the air with Windows 7 64-bit. I utilized the present drivers from the Hauppauge web site rather than *possibly* outdated software in the box. It operates nicely with Windows Media Center and contains low profile slots for slim Pc systems. The picture quality is eggscellent ; ) The IR receiver hardly ever worked when I installed the card into the PCI x1 slot with the best physical place in my Dell Studio 540 Pc. Even right after running the utility system to choose/activate the remote, only 1 of 15 pushes on any button responded. Following exhausting all affordable selections, I moved the card to the one more obtainable x1 slot. This changed the IRQ assigned to the card, and the remote receiver now functions 3 out of 4 occasions. While mainly functional, this will generate larger difficulties if I use a Media Center IR keyboard with the receiver : ( This card design and style has been changed by the manufacturer because initial introduced. Initially it shipped with a USB Media Center receiver which worked WONDERFULLY. I removed 1 star for the intense aggravation I blame on this design adjust.

The WinTV-HVR-2250 has two tuners for watching one TV program while recording another: with the built-in dual tuners, you can either watch one channel while recording another or you can record two channels at once.

Create your own personal Digital Video Recorder! Record analog cable TV shows to your PC's hard disk with our built-in high quality MPEG-2 hardware encoder. You can also record high definition digital ATSC and clear QAM digital cable TV to disk in the original digital quality. Use the WinTV-Scheduler to schedule the recordings of your favorite analog or digital TV programs. Play the recordings back to your PC screen at any time.

Vista Media Center compatible: The Microsoft Media Center application supports two TV tuners. Use the Media Center scheduler to schedule your TV recordings. And WinTV-HVR-2250 has Windows Vista Premium certification.

Clear QAM TV channels are unencrypted digital TV channels broadcast by your local cable operator. Many cable operators in North America are transmitting the high definition ATSC channels on their cable networks. They also broadcast the basic cable channels in using clear QAM. You can use the WinTV v6 application to watch and record these channels. Note: currently Media Center cannot be used for clear QAM digital TV.

ATSC digital TV is the over-the-air HD digital TV for North America. ATSC digital TV typically requires an antenna for reception, and is currently broadcast in 200 cities, with over 1500 TV stations. ATSC broadcasts range in resolution from standard definition up to the high definition 1080i format. The WinTV-HVR can be used to watch and record all ATSC formats. Note: ATSC digital TV is NOT digital cable TV or digital satellite TV. ATSC is digital "over-the-air" TV.

ATSC digital TV brings you sharper pictures and enriches your PC?s multimedia experience with near CD quality sound. WinTV-HVR?s ATSC digital TV tuner adds great features to your TV viewing: high definition TV reception, automatic identification of channel names plus records high-definition digital TV programs to your PC?s hard disk in an MPEG-2 format without any loss in quality.

Technically speaking: WinTV-HVR-2250 is a PCI Express X1 board based on the NXP 7164 bus interface chip. The WinTV-HVR-2250 contains two tuners with a built-in TV splitter. There is one cable TV or TV antenna connector which is split, providing a video source for both tuners. For ATSC and QAM digital TV, all 18 ATSC formats including 1080i can be watched or recorded to disk as a MPEG-2 Program Stream. The NXP 7164 contains two highly integrated MPEG-1/2 hardware encoders for recording analog cable TV to disk. The playback of the recorded ATSC and QAM digital TV and MPEG-2 encoded analog programs are done through a software MPEG-2 player.

Note: For Analog TV reception, you need an analog cable TV connection. If you have a digital cable set top box or a satellite box, you can connect via either Composite or S-Video inputs. Channel changing will be done using the IR blaster. The WinTV-HVR-2250 has two Media Center compatible IR blaster outputs for controlling two cable TV or satellite set top boxes.
